Studio MAPPA delivers some of the most fluid, breathtaking fight animation in modern history. The power system (Cursed Energy) is deeply tactical, and the stakes feel genuinely dangerous because beloved characters face real consequences. Living with a mother-in-law can be challenging, but it's also an opportunity to build a stronger relationship and learn from each other's experiences. By communicating openly and respectfully, establishing boundaries, showing appreciation and respect, and seeking support, you can navigate the complexities of intergenerational living.
